The device is equipped with a 23.8-inch IPS LCD display. The panel has FHD resolution, 100Hz refresh rate, 16.7 million colours and covers 99% of the sRGB colour gamut. The thickness of the monitor is only 7.5 mm. The novelty comes with DisplayPort 1.4 and HDMI ports, as well as a stand.

The attackers created a deepfake of the CFO of one of Hong Kong's largest corporations and, during a video conference, convinced a company employee to transfer $25 million to them.
